Increased Expression of<i>ZFPM2</i>Bypasses<i>SRY</i>to Drive 46,XX Testicular Development: A New Mechanism of 46,XX DSD

2024-05-28

Abstract excerpt

We present a patient with a novel cause of 46,XX ambiguous/androgenous genitalia Differences of Sex Development (DSD). Genome-wide array from blood showed 46,XX with ∼35% mosaic duplication of 76.5 Mb at chromosome 8q13.2-q24.3, containing 257 OMIM genes including ZFPM2 and CYP11B1 .
